12055: Updated fake driver to make integration tests work again.
authorLucas Di Pentima <ldipentima@veritasgenetics.com>
Wed, 16 Aug 2017 03:52:56 +0000 (00:52 -0300)
committerLucas Di Pentima <ldipentima@veritasgenetics.com>
Wed, 16 Aug 2017 03:52:56 +0000 (00:52 -0300)
Arvados-DCO-1.1-Signed-off-by: Lucas Di Pentima <ldipentima@veritasgenetics.com>

build/libcloud-pin.sh
services/nodemanager/arvnodeman/test/fake_driver.py

index 8d71097e136355fb25868c83cb762e4fb57f7142..1ddb776df6bbc3e89be7838cd4040496434c9db8 100644 (file)
@@ -2,4 +2,4 @@
 #
 # SPDX-License-Identifier: AGPL-3.0
 
-LIBCLOUD_PIN=0.20.2.dev3
\ No newline at end of file
+LIBCLOUD_PIN=0.20.2.dev4
\ No newline at end of file
index a34e3668457a3fad961bce90c0f816bc037fbd46..9cb582c953a8a2ed3a6e012e65a3cbf6d7854b45 100644 (file)
@@ -150,11 +150,13 @@ class FakeAwsDriver(FakeDriver):
                     image=None,
                     auth=None,
                     ex_userdata=None,
+                    ex_metadata=None,
                     ex_blockdevicemappings=None):
         n = super(FakeAwsDriver, self).create_node(name=name,
                                                       size=size,
                                                       image=image,
                                                       auth=auth,
+                                                      ex_metadata=ex_metadata,
                                                       ex_userdata=ex_userdata)
         n.extra = {"launch_time": time.strftime(ARVADOS_TIMEFMT, time.gmtime())[:-1]}
         return n